### Action Item: Spoolhaven Retry Storm

From last Tuesday's outage: the Spoolhaven print service retried failed jobs without backoff, saturating the render pool. Fix merged; retries now use capped exponential backoff with jitter. Owner will monitor for a week before closing. The agreed retry constants are recorded below.

constants for yadup-kajof:
RATE_LIMITS = {
    "zorwyn": 1,
    "druwyn": 1,
}

CI note: the Corvane partner SFTP drop job intermittently fails with a truncated-upload error. Root cause was the runner recycling mid-transfer when the nightly window overlapped the fleet scale-down. Fixed by tagging the job to the long-lived pool and adding a resume-on-partial step. If it recurs, check the pool tag first before touching retry logic. The last known-good run is recorded below.

session token of kageg-kajep = htk31_8e387f741d208554faee18934428597

## TICKET-418: Retry logic for failed exports

The Maroweld reporting service currently drops exports that fail mid-transfer. This ticket adds a retry queue with exponential backoff (max three attempts) and a dead-letter table for anything that still fails. As a new contractor, please note: changes to the export pipeline require an explicit sign-off before merge — no exceptions, even for small patches. Implementation details are in the linked design doc. The sign-off for this ticket must come from the engineer named below.

account owner for fajep-yagef: Kasix Eliiel